drparameter_index.html 8.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176
  1. <!DOCTYPE html>
  2. <html>
  3. <head>
  4. <meta charset="utf-8" />
  5. <meta name="keywords" content="dongke,mes,ibossmes">
  6. <meta name="description" content="制造企业生产过程执行管理系统">
  7. <meta name="author" content="xuwei">
  8. <title>东科软件</title>
  9. <script src="/plugins/xeasyui/xeasyui.min.js"></script>
  10. <link href="/plugins/xeasyui/toolbar.min.css" rel="stylesheet" />
  11. </head>
  12. <body>
  13. <!--工具条-->
  14. <div id="tbPara" class="i-toolbar">
  15. <a href="javascript:void(0)" style="display:none" id="btnInsert" title="添加" class="easyui-linkbutton" iconcls="icon-add" plain="true" onclick="tbParaAdd()">添加</a>
  16. <a href="javascript:void(0)" style="display:none" id="btnUpdate" title="编辑" class="easyui-linkbutton" iconcls="icon-edit" plain="true" onclick="tbParaEdit()">修改</a>
  17. <a href="javascript:void(0)" style="display:none" id="btnDelete" title="删除" class="easyui-linkbutton" iconcls="icon-remove" plain="true" onclick="tbParaDelete()">删除</a>
  18. <a href="javascript:void(0)" style="display:none" id="btnDetail" title="详细" class="easyui-linkbutton" iconcls="icon-detail" plain="true" onclick="tbParaDetail()">详细</a>
  19. <a href="javascript:void(0)" style="display:none" id="btnCheckbox" title="显示复选框" class="easyui-linkbutton" iconcls="icon-ok" plain="true" toggle="true" onclick="tbParaCheck()">复选</a>
  20. <a href="javascript:void(0)" style="display:none" id="btnSearch" title="搜索" class="easyui-linkbutton" iconcls="icon-search" plain="true" toggle="true" onclick="tbParaSearch()">搜索</a>
  21. <a href="javascript:void(0)" style="display:none" id="btnExport" title="导出" class="easyui-linkbutton" iconcls="icon-excel" plain="true" onclick="tbParaExport()">导出</a>
  22. <a href="javascript:void(0)" id="btnReload" title="刷新" class="easyui-linkbutton" iconcls="icon-reload" plain="true" onclick="tbParaReload()">刷新</a>
  23. <div id="tbParaSearchDiv" style="display:none;padding:10px;">
  24. <form id="ff">
  25. <div>
  26. 报表ID:
  27. <input class="easyui-textbox" id="REPORTID" name="REPORTID" data-options="required:false,prompt:'',tipPosition:'bottom'" style="width:80px;height:32px;">
  28. 参数编码:
  29. <input class="easyui-textbox" id="PARAMETERCODE" name="PARAMETERCODE" data-options="required:false,prompt:'',tipPosition:'bottom'" style="width:80px;height:32px;">
  30. 参数名称:
  31. <input class="easyui-textbox" id="PARAMETERNAME" name="PARAMETERNAME" data-options="required:false,prompt:'',tipPosition:'bottom'" style="width:80px;height:32px;">
  32. 参数种类:
  33. <input class="easyui-textbox" id="PARAMETERKIND" name="PARAMETERKIND" data-options="required:false,prompt:'',tipPosition:'bottom'" style="width:80px;height:32px;">
  34. 参数类型:
  35. <input class="easyui-textbox" id="PARAMETERTYPE" name="PARAMETERTYPE" data-options="required:false,prompt:'',tipPosition:'bottom'" style="width:80px;height:32px;">
  36. 备注:
  37. <input class="easyui-textbox" id="REMARKS" name="REMARKS" data-options="required:false,prompt:'',tipPosition:'bottom'" style="width:80px;height:32px;">
  38. <a href="javascript:void(0)" id="btnSearchSubmit" title="清空" class="easyui-linkbutton" plain="false" onclick="$('#ff').form('clear')">清空</a>
  39. <a href="javascript:void(0)" id="btnSearchSubmit" title="搜索" class="easyui-linkbutton" plain="false" onclick="tbParaSearchSubmit()">搜索</a>
  40. </div>
  41. </form>
  42. </div>
  43. </div>
  44. <!--表格-->
  45. <table id="dgPara" data-options="toolbar: '#tbPara',onDblClickRow: dgParaDblclickrow,showFooter:false">
  46. <!--
  47. <thead data-options="frozen:true">
  48. <tr>
  49. <th data-options="field:'标识',align:'left',sortable:true">标识</th>
  50. </tr>
  51. </thead>
  52. -->
  53. <thead>
  54. <tr>
  55. <th data-options="field:'SID',title:'SID',width:220,align:'left',checkbox:true,hidden:true">SID</th>
  56. <th data-options="field:'REPORTID',title:'报表ID',align:'left',sortable:true"></th>
  57. <th data-options="field:'PARAMETERID',title:'参数ID',align:'left',sortable:true"></th>
  58. <th data-options="field:'DISPLAYNO',title:'显示顺序',align:'left',sortable:true"></th>
  59. <th data-options="field:'PARAMETERCODE',title:'参数编码',align:'left',sortable:true"></th>
  60. <th data-options="field:'PARAMETERNAME',title:'参数名称',align:'left',sortable:true"></th>
  61. <th data-options="field:'PARAMETERKIND',title:'参数种类',align:'left',sortable:true"></th>
  62. <th data-options="field:'PARAMETERTYPE',title:'参数类型',align:'left',sortable:true"></th>
  63. <th data-options="field:'FORMAT',title:'格式',align:'left',sortable:true"></th>
  64. <th data-options="field:'MUSTINPUT',title:'必须输入',align:'left',sortable:true"></th>
  65. <th data-options="field:'REMARKS',title:'备注',align:'left',sortable:true"></th>
  66. <th data-options="field:'VALUEFLAG',title:'有效标识',align:'left',sortable:true"></th>
  67. <th data-options="field:'ACCOUNTID',title:'账套ID',align:'left',sortable:true"></th>
  68. <th data-options="field:'CREATEUSERID',title:'创建工号ID',align:'left',sortable:true"></th>
  69. <th data-options="field:'CREATETIME',title:'创建时间',align:'left',sortable:true"></th>
  70. <th data-options="field:'UPDATEUSERID',title:'更新工号ID',align:'left',sortable:true"></th>
  71. <th data-options="field:'UPDATETIME',title:'更新时间',align:'left',sortable:true"></th>
  72. </tr>
  73. </thead>
  74. </table>
  75. <script type="text/javascript">
  76. //加载完成
  77. $(function () {
  78. //加载按钮
  79. $('#tbPara').buttonLoad({
  80. url:'drparameter.ashx?m=b'
  81. });
  82. //加载表格数据
  83. tbParaSearchSubmit();
  84. });
  85. //添加按钮
  86. function tbParaAdd() {
  87. $('#dgPara').datagridDialog({
  88. title: '添加数据',
  89. width: 640,
  90. height: 480,
  91. url: 'drparameter_add.html'
  92. });
  93. }
  94. //修改按钮
  95. function tbParaEdit() {
  96. $('#dgPara').datagridDialog({
  97. title: '修改数据',
  98. width: 640,
  99. height: 480,
  100. url: 'drparameter_edit.html',
  101. requireSelect: true
  102. });
  103. }
  104. //删除按钮
  105. function tbParaDelete() {
  106. $('#dgPara').datagridPost({
  107. title: '删除操作',
  108. datagridid: 'dgPara',
  109. url: 'drparameter.ashx?m=d',
  110. onValidate: function (r) { return true; }
  111. });
  112. }
  113. //详细按钮
  114. function tbParaDetail() {
  115. $('#dgPara').datagridDialog({
  116. title: '详细数据',
  117. width: 640,
  118. height: 480,
  119. url: 'drparameter_detail.html',
  120. requireSelect: true
  121. });
  122. }
  123. //复选按钮
  124. function tbParaCheck() {
  125. $('#dgPara').datagridCheckbox({
  126. buttonid: 'btnCheckbox',
  127. valuefield: 'SID'
  128. });
  129. }
  130. //搜索按钮
  131. function tbParaSearch() {
  132. $('#tbParaSearchDiv').toggle();
  133. $('#dgPara').datagrid('resize');
  134. }
  135. //搜索提交
  136. function tbParaSearchSubmit() {
  137. $('#dgPara').datagridLoad({
  138. title: '报表参数',
  139. idField: 'SID',
  140. queryParams: $('#ff').serializeJson(),
  141. url: 'drparameter.ashx?m=s'
  142. });
  143. }
  144. //导出
  145. function tbParaExport() {
  146. $('#dgPara').datagridExport({
  147. fileName: '导出数据(报表参数).xls',
  148. workSheet: '导出数据(报表参数)'
  149. });
  150. }
  151. //刷新
  152. function tbParaReload() {
  153. tbParaSearchSubmit();
  154. }
  155. //表格双击
  156. function dgParaDblclickrow(rowIndex, rowData) {
  157. tbParaDetail();
  158. }
  159. function formatterTrueFalse(value, row, index) { return value == 'True' ? '是' : '否'; }
  160. function stylerTrueFalse(value, row, index) { return value == 'True' ? 'color:black' : 'color:red'; }
  161. </script>
  162. </body>
  163. </html>